There are various methods of removing tattoos in Charlotte some of them can be discussed as below:

Removing tattoos with surgery: This is the most traditional way to remove tattoos. Even though this is a very simple procedure where tattoo skin is removed through surgical procedures, but leave scars.

Cryosurgery: Cryosurgery aka Cryotherapy removes tattoos with the help of nitrogen fluid, but unfortunately also left the lesion.

How does it work?

In laser treatment, a high-intensity laser is focused on the area where the tattoo is made. This laser detects the tone difference between the skin and the ink colour. The laser breaks down the ink pigments to a limit that they are absorbed by the skin.

Initially, your scar will look like a burn but applying regular anti-biotic ointments and bandaging the burn will lead to little or no scar.
